V2EX = way to explore
V2EX 是一个关于分享和探索的地方
现在注册
已注册用户请  登录
V2EX 提问指南
kidlj
V2EX  ›  问与答

关于 GitHub 仓库内搜索漏掉文件的一个奇怪问题

  •  
  •   kidlj · 2016-04-11 17:57:45 +08:00 · 1209 次点击
    这是一个创建于 3149 天前的主题,其中的信息可能已经有所发展或是发生改变。

    为什么 GitHub 上有些文件明明在仓库里,它的内容却在搜索时索引不到?

    遇到问题的是 vue-hackernews 仓库:

    https://github.com/vuejs/vue-hackernews

    这个仓库里有一个文件 https://github.com/vuejs/vue-hackernews/blob/gh-pages/static/build.js ,它的第 3 行有如下内容:

    @copyright Copyright (c) 2014 Yehuda Katz, Tom Dale, Stefan Penner

    然后在本仓库搜索 "Yehuda",结果显示没有匹配内容。事实上build.js 里的所有内容都被搜索给漏掉了。

    请问这是什么原因?

    3 条回复    2016-04-12 15:50:51 +08:00
    Hodor
        1
    Hodor  
       2016-04-12 02:23:39 +08:00
    关注
    SpicyCat
        2
    SpicyCat  
       2016-04-12 09:13:49 +08:00
    试了下,只能理解为 github 认为那个 build.js 不是 code file ,所以搜索 code 就把它排除了。打开它的时候连语法高亮都没有。
    kidlj
        3
    kidlj  
    OP
       2016-04-12 15:50:51 +08:00
    @SpicyCat 嗯嗯,只能这么理解了。
    关于   ·   帮助文档   ·   博客   ·   API   ·   FAQ   ·   实用小工具   ·   2653 人在线   最高记录 6679   ·     Select Language
    创意工作者们的社区
    World is powered by solitude
    VERSION: 3.9.8.5 · 22ms · UTC 10:55 · PVG 18:55 · LAX 02:55 · JFK 05:55
    Developed with CodeLauncher
    ♥ Do have faith in what you're doing.